Mr. William A. Carnes, son of Mr. "Pat" Carnes of Cross, Tex., died
recently in that state and his funeral will be preached on the second
Sunday in December the 8th. As Mr. Carnes family formerly lived near Esom
Hill in this county, his funeral will also be preached at Shiloh church on
the same date by Rev. G. B. Boman. All friends of the Carnes and Isbell
families are invited to attend. (Cedartown Standard, November 28, 1901)
